Do not use VARCHAR _anywhere_ for DATEs or DATETIMEs. That include SP parameters, expressions, columns, etc.

(Yes, there are exceptions.)

SHOW CREATE PROCEDURE PopulateClassWeek;
If that fails to show the charset and collation for the SP, then rummage in information_schema to find it.

SHOW CREATE TABLE for the table involved.
